標籤:

視覺系統選型及搭建—工業相機篇

相信很多用戶在初次接觸到機器視覺時,面對如何將自己的項目需求與視覺系統眾多的參數進行對應,感到非常困惑,今天維視小編主要從項目角度出發,講解如何將項目需求轉換為對視覺系統的參數要求。

一般的視覺系統包含工業相機、工業鏡頭、視覺光源、圖像處理軟體、感測器、運動及控制裝置等,在有項目檢測需求,並進行選型前,需要明確,本次項目預計的結構(包括安裝環境、工位數量、可安裝設備空間)、是否運動、需要檢測的精度、檢測速度、軟體開發的語言和工具、是否藉助第三方工具等,下面維視小編開始詳細介紹如何進行選型,主要針對視覺部分,將這些需求細化與參數結合。

常見的選型順序是工業相機->工業鏡頭->視覺光源->外圍設備……

工業相機(主要針對面陣相機)

1、面陣相機/線陣相機

對於靜止檢測或者一般低速的檢測,優先考慮面陣相機,對於大幅面高速運動或者滾軸等運動的特殊應用考慮使用線陣相機;

2、解析度

解析度實際就是指相機像素點的個數,也就是通常說的多少萬像素,但在檢測時,並不一定要追求過高的像素,像素高會帶來幀率下降、圖像處理慢的情況,選擇時可根據項目檢測精度要求來選擇,項目的精度在圖像中佔1個像素為基本要求,軟體水平弱一些的工程師可以選擇3個像素或以上;

3、幀率

儘可能選取靜止檢測,這樣整個項目成本都會降低很多,但是會帶來檢測效率的下降,對於有運動的,選用幀曝光相機,行曝光相機則會引起畫面變形,對於具體幀率的選擇,不應盲目的選擇高速相機,雖然高速相機幀率高,但是一般需要外加強光照射,帶來的高成本以及圖像處理速度也壓力巨大,需要根據相對運動速度來定,只要在檢測區域內,能捕捉到被測物即可,比如觀測長度方向1米的視野,被測物以10米/秒的運動速度穿過視野,只需要10-12幀/秒的速度就完全可以捕捉到被測物,但同樣速度穿過0.1米的視野,則需要100-120幀/秒的相機才行。

4、色彩

工業上的視覺檢測,一般我們都推薦使用黑白相機,因為軟體處理一般都是轉換為灰度數據來處理,並且工業上的彩色相機都是經過Bayer演算法轉換的彩色,與真實色彩還是有一定的差距;

5、晶元類型、大小及像素尺寸

就目前行業現狀來看,對於圖像質量要求較高,或者環境照度較差的情況下,建議使用CCD感測器並選擇較大像素尺寸的相機,當然隨著行業的發展CCD和CMOS之間差距也在逐步減小,CMOS則改變解析度(ROI)更加靈活,同樣解析度,速率也更高。

除了以上參數,在確定相機之前,最好確認相機是否支持項目要求的開發語言或者開發工具,是否兼容使用到的Halcon、VisionPro、Labview等第三方工具。

今天主要介紹根據項目需求對相機的選型,下期我們會繼續介紹鏡頭及光源的選型技巧,感興趣的小夥伴可以關注我們哦!

轉載請註明出處!


推薦閱讀:

用於三維重建和3d deep learning的公開數據集
淺談深度學習的技術原理及其在計算機視覺的應用
【生成高清人臉】ProgressiveGAN 筆記
[計算機視覺論文速遞] 2018-03-30

TAG:計算機視覺 |